You are right Nigel,when I saw the first time the picture of Yellowdrama III and Unowot toghether in 1977 I didn't believe that!
After three years in white colour the old Enfield 37' came back to the light blue!
Then in 1979 it came back to the white when it became Uno Mint Jewellery!

The king of Spain had a tin boat as well. I got to strip that boat around 2000 as they would not sell the complete boat to me. 6 month later I was offered the hull for free but turned it down due to logistics. It was later sold to Germany and last I heard it was reriged with #6 drives and 1100 HP engines. I only have paper pictures of this boat and no scanner so I cant post pictures sorry.
